Resurfacing a July move: Former Myntra chief Nandita Sinha to lead Swiggy Instamart

Nandita Sinha succeeded Amitesh Jha as Instamart CEO in a July 29 shakeup, while former Instamart COO Ankit Jain joined Nykaa Now as quick-commerce beauty players sharpened leadership benches and expansion plans.

Why this matters

Swiggy and Nykaa’s senior hires highlight the value of acquiring or partnering for specialized category, supply-chain and rapid-delivery capabilities rather than relying solely on organic buildouts.

What to watch

  • Changes in Instamart’s SKU mix, especially beauty, personal care, apparel basics and accessories.
  • New brand-exclusive or rapid-launch partnerships with beauty and fashion labels.
  • Dark-store additions and assortment expansion in Mumbai, Bengaluru, Delhi NCR and other high-density metros.
  • Instamart order-value, contribution-margin and advertising-revenue disclosures or management commentary.
  • Nykaa Now’s city expansion, delivery promise, inventory model and customer-acquisition intensity.
  • Competitive responses from Blinkit and Zepto in beauty, premium personal care and lifestyle categories.
